摘要:,,前端设计的思路从概念到实现,首先需明确设计目标与用户需求,形成清晰的概念设计。接着进行界面布局和交互设计,注重用户体验和易用性。然后利用HTML、CSS和JavaScript等前端技术,将设计转化为可视化的界面。最后进行功能实现和测试优化,确保前端功能完善并与后端数据交互顺畅。整个过程需不断迭代优化,以呈现最佳的用户体验。
随着互联网技术的飞速发展,前端设计在构建优秀用户体验中扮演着至关重要的角色,前端设计思路的清晰与否,直接关系到产品的用户体验和市场竞争力,本文将探讨前端设计的思路,包括需求分析、设计原则、技术选型、页面布局、交互设计以及优化等方面。
需求分析
1、明确设计目标:在开始前端设计之前,首先要明确设计目标,包括产品的定位、用户需求、市场趋势等,只有明确了目标,才能确保设计方向正确。
2、用户调研:通过用户调研,了解用户的习惯、需求和痛点,从而设计出更符合用户需求的产品。
3、竞品分析:分析市场上同类型产品的优缺点,取长补短,设计出更具竞争力的产品。
设计原则
1、简洁明了:设计要简洁明了,避免过多的视觉元素,使用户能够轻松理解产品功能。
2、一致性:在设计过程中要保持一致性,包括设计风格、色彩、字体等,以提高用户体验。
3、可访问性:确保所有用户都能方便地访问和使用产品,包括不同设备、浏览器和操作系统。
4、响应式布局:随着移动设备的使用越来越普遍,设计应适应不同屏幕尺寸,提供一致的体验。
技术选型
1、框架选择:根据需求选择合适的前端框架,如React、Vue、Angular等,以提高开发效率和代码质量。
2、组件库:选用合适的组件库,可以加快开发速度,同时保证页面的性能和体验。
3、开发工具:选择高效的开发工具,如代码编辑器、版本控制工具等,提高开发效率。
页面布局
1、网格系统:采用网格系统来布局页面,可以提高页面的灵活性和适应性。
2、响应式设计:确保页面在不同设备和屏幕尺寸上都能正常显示,提供良好的用户体验。
3、页面结构:合理划分页面结构,如头部、导航、主内容、侧边栏、底部等,使用户能够轻松找到所需信息。
交互设计
1、用户体验流程:设计清晰的用户体验流程,包括用户登录、注册、浏览、购买等,确保用户在使用过程中能够轻松完成任务。
2、动画与过渡:合理使用动画和过渡效果,提高用户体验和页面的趣味性。
3、反馈与提示:及时给出反馈和提示,让用户了解操作结果和进度,提高用户满意度。
优化
1、性能优化:优化页面加载速度、减少资源请求、压缩图片等,提高页面性能。
2、兼容性优化:确保页面在不同浏览器和操作系统上的兼容性,提高用户体验。
3、A/B测试:通过A/B测试来评估设计改动的效果,以便持续改进和优化。
前端设计的思路是一个综合性的过程,涉及到需求分析、设计原则、技术选型、页面布局、交互设计以及优化等方面,在设计过程中,需要始终以用户体验为中心,结合市场需求和产品定位,设计出符合用户习惯和需求的产品,需要关注技术发展趋势,不断学习和掌握新技术,以提高开发效率和产品质量,才能设计出优秀的前端产品,提升用户体验和产品的市场竞争力。
评论(0)